Zayn Malik’s New Direction
Zayn Malik, the former One Direction member known for his distinctive voice and versatile musical style, might be taking his talents to an entirely new genre. Fans are buzzing with excitement and curiosity after country music producer Dave Cobb hinted that Zayn’s next album could feature country music influences.
Collaboration with Grammy-Winning Producer Dave Cobb
In a recent interview with Rolling Stone, Cobb, a Grammy-winning producer from Nashville, spoke about his collaboration with Malik. “What got me about Zayn was his voice; you can hear love, loss, pain, triumph, and humanity in it,” Cobb shared. “I feel as if this record is removing the glass from his spirit directly to his fans.” Cobb, known for his work with country legends such as Chris Stapleton and Brandi Carlile, is co-producing the album with Malik, which has fans speculating about the sound of the upcoming project.
Fans React to Zayn’s Genre Shift
Zayn’s pivot to country music comes as a surprise to many, considering his past work in pop and R&B. However, Cobb emphasized how Malik is creating his own unique musical universe for this record, expressing no fear in opening up and sharing his raw emotions with his listeners. “Zayn really has no fear and is speaking straight from his soul,” Cobb added.
Fans have shared mixed reactions to the news on social media. While some are enthusiastic about the direction Malik is taking, others are less convinced. “Zayn is a very versatile artist. Let’s give him a chance with this country music,” one fan posted, while another reacted more skeptically, writing, “Zayn going country?? I’m sick to my stomach.” The varied responses highlight the curiosity and anticipation surrounding this unexpected genre shift.
New Album Teases and Personal Inspiration
This revelation adds fuel to Malik’s previous statements about his musical evolution. Last year, in an appearance on the Call Her Daddy podcast, Malik teased that his upcoming album would feature a sound that “people are really not going to expect.” He also mentioned that the project would include narratives based on real-life experiences, with his daughter Khai—whom he shares with ex-girlfriend Gigi Hadid—appearing in a few tracks.
Fans have been eagerly awaiting new music from Malik, as his last studio album, Nobody Is Listening (2021), was well received. Prior to that, he released three solo albums, including Mind of Mine (2016) and Icarus (2018). He has also dabbled in other styles, with his surprise rap project Yellow Tape in 2021 showcasing his willingness to explore different genres.
Zayn’s Genre Exploration Trend
Zayn Malik is not the only artist to experiment with country music recently. Superstars like Beyoncé, Lana Del Rey, and Post Malone have also ventured into the genre, further blurring the lines between traditional country music and other styles. Beyoncé made history with her song “Texas Hold ‘Em,” which topped the country charts, becoming the first Black woman to achieve such a feat.
